I installed ssmtp from ports to take the place of sendmail.  I've never
successfully gotten sendmail configured, but I use ssmtp happily on
Linux.  I was wondering what I need to do or change in order to get
ssmtp to work.  When I try to send an email (trying simply just with
'mail' first), I get this error:

bash-2.05$ send-mail: can't open the smtp port (25) on mail.

I know that rc.conf has to have the sendmail_enable="YES" in it for
using sendmail, but do I need to do something like this for ssmtp?

Any insight or pointers would be great.
